Running a restaurant is already a high-pressure job. Add in the task of scheduling restaurant staff, and it can feel like you’re constantly playing catch-up. But it doesn’t have to be this way.
If you’ve ever wrestled with sticky notes, group messages, or last-minute shift swaps, you’re not alone. With the right restaurant staff scheduling software and strategy, this process can become smooth, fast, and even stress-free.
Step 1: Use Data to Staff Smarter
Stop guessing and start using sales data. Review your recent sales reports to pinpoint peak hours and slow days.
By aligning restaurant staffing with demand, you’ll avoid being overstaffed on a Monday or scrambling for help on a Saturday night.
Pro Tip: Aim for a labor-to-sales ratio of 25-35% to balance service quality with cost-efficiency.
Step 2: Build Shift Templates by Role
Templates are your best friend. Create default schedules for common roles, like hosts, cooks, and bartenders, to reduce weekly planning time.
Inefficient scheduling restaurant staff becomes streamlined when you don’t start from scratch every week.
Step 3: Let Staff Manage Their Own Scheduling
Using a smart restaurant staffing app, allow team members to:
- Submit availability
- Request time off
- Swap shifts with manager approval
This promotes autonomy and reduces back-and-forth, helping both morale and productivity. Bonus: many apps automatically flag compliance issues like overtime.
Step 4: Schedule With Forecasting Tools
Guesswork is out, data is in. Advanced scheduling restaurant staff software can predict labor needs using:
- Sales history
- Special events and holidays
- Even local weather patterns
These insights help you staff appropriately every day of the week.
Step 5: Post Schedules Consistently
Nothing frustrates employees more than uncertainty. Choose one day to release schedules each week, at least 7 days in advance. Respecting their time builds trust and loyalty.
Step 6: Review, Learn, and Improve Weekly
Spend 10 minutes reviewing your schedule each week. Ask:
- Were there last-minute changes or no-shows?
- Did labor costs exceed your target?
- Did your schedule meet actual demand?
This small step leads to big improvements over time.
Want Scheduling to Practically Run Itself?
Our restaurant staffing app is built to take these headaches off your plate. You’ll be able to:
- Create and manage shifts effortlessly
- Let staff clock in/out and manage availability
- Monitor key metrics and labor performance
- Handle onboarding and scheduling from one place
Book a free demo and see how easy restaurant employee scheduling can be.
You opened a restaurant to serve amazing food, not to manage spreadsheets and shifts. With smart scheduling restaurant staff software, you can focus on what you do best while keeping your team happy and efficient.
How Enginehire Can Help
Enginehire offers a powerful, user-friendly platform that brings automation, flexibility, and clarity to restaurant staff scheduling. With real-time availability, shift planning, and labor tracking in one place, you’ll save hours each week while improving team satisfaction and performance.
Whether you’re running one location or managing a growing chain, Enginehire scales with your business needs.
Know why our customers rate Enginehire as the best ATS for staffing agencies
Sarah M.
When I first spoke with Enginehire I thought the price was a little steep and almost did not move forward. Ever since then the price is worth every penny. If I ever need anything updated, they respond almost immediately with a solution. They are continuously working to keep the system updated and always adding new features Read full review Founder of Nannies Coast to Coast
Debra Fortosis
I have used two other management platforms and I can tell you that Enginehire is the best. Want a one-stop shop? You can match people to jobs, build resumes directly from their profiles, and so much more in seconds. Enginehire has saved me money by saving me time. Read full review Elite Family Care

James McCrossen
Enginehire has been a game-changer for my agency. One of the biggest standouts is their tech support. Using Enginehire has genuinely helped me become more efficient and streamlined our operations. Highly recommend it to any agency owner looking to level up. Read full review Manny and Me
Amelia D’Urso
,
I should have done this months ago. I waited out of fear and concern that automation wouldn't be the right fit for such a personalized service. I was so wrong and I'm kicking my past self for waiting! Any agency that is on the fence or considering Enginehire should just take the plunge. It is worth every penny! Read full review Amelia's Nannies
Lydia B – Owner of
The Enginehire Team have been excellent to work with and provide phenomenal customer service . Their knowledge of the industry and individual customization is unparalleled and their platform has revolutionized the way that my team does business. Read full review Sommet Nannies
Ruka Curate
We have used so many platforms. From iCims to Bullhorn, to trying to create ones ourselves with Zoho, Asana, Monday.com, Trello, and Airtable. They just did not work for our industry. Enginhire has created a logical system that is simple to use with lots of amazing features. I am so glad we found them. Read full review Tiny Treasures NYC

George Johnson
The software is brilliant, it is the only one we could find in our 4 years of looking that would do exactly what we wanted. It has honestly taken a huge amount of admin of our hands. It is is almost 100% customisable. Read full review Peace and Riot UK
Deniz Hanson
The Enginehire team was absolutely wonderful to work with; professional, dedicated, and supportive. I cannot recommend Enginehire enough if you're looking for a way to streamline your processes and work with a patient and understanding team. Read full review Trusted Nanny Match